    warp feed in mechanical mode?

    I bought the cable to run from my xmag board to the warp feed so it will feed on the trigger pull but then right before I installed it something occurred to me. What happens if I am in mechanical mode, will my warp know when to feed? I'm thinking that it wont if I set the jumpers to what they should be when connected to the board! The only reason why this worries me is because if I am in the middle of a game and I am forced to switched to mech mode for any reason i'd still be done!
